West is not West

For those of you traveling in Texas, be sure to stop in West, Texas, the heart of the Czech community in this region.  However, West is not west.  In other words, the community of West is not in west Texas.  It’s actually in the central part of Texas and was founded in 1882.  It’s located on I-35 between Dallas-Ft. Worth and Austin.   

West is famous for its Czech Stop & Little Czech Bakery which is well known for its “kolaches” (pastry buns filled with either fruit, poppy seeds, cream cheese, or sausage) and also for its cakes, pies, cookies, breads, and fudge.  They also serve a variety of sandwiches.
